Eritrean superstar Daniel Teklehaymanot today claimed a shining Gold and a 2011 African Individual Time Trial title after winning today’s daunting 36Km competition of the African Cycling Championship.
Janse Van Rensburg and Meint Jes Louis, both from South Africa, finished the race second and third respectively.
Despite his frustration on losing the team time trial title on Wednesday, Janse Van Rensburg had vowed to win all the remaining Gold medals in the upcoming two competitions. However, today he was conveniently beaten by his bitter rival Daniel Teklahaymanot of Eritrea.
Eritrea was represented in today’s ITT race by Daniel Teklehaymanot and Frekalsi Debesay only.
In the Women’s race, South African rider Cherise Taylor and her compatriot Ashleigh Moolman Pasio won Gold and Silver after clocking the 18Km out-and-back course with a time of 24:38 and 24:58 respectively.
This first and second place win gives South Africa 13 points in the International Cycling Union’s nation rankings, which are used to determine number of start places at the 2012 London Olympic Games.
